## v1.9 — New defaults

Heads up: Pixelbarn now scrubs EXIF data from uploaded images by default instead of opt-in. GPS tags, camera serials, the works — all stripped before storage. If a client genuinely needs metadata kept, there's a per-bucket override, but get approval first. Since you're new, here's where the behavior lives: the scrubber reads its settings from the block below.

deployment values, kajep-kageg:
[praix]
host = praix.paliqcorp.corp
user = praix_svc
database = praix_prod

Finance Review — Annual Billing Shift

Quick summary for the board: moving Pellworth subscribers to annual billing should pull roughly 1.4m forward in cash, with churn modelled at a manageable 3%. Discount drag is the main watch-item. Finance recommends a phased rollout starting with the Oakhurst tier. One confidential point on our plans sits just below.

confidential, kagep-kahof: Druokax Systems plans to lower the Ulaath list price by 53 percent in March.

Action item: The Relayn deploy-status bot silently dropped updates when the pipeline API paginated results, so responders believed a rollback had completed when it had not. We will add pagination handling, a staleness banner, and an integration test. Until merged, verify deploy state directly in the pipeline console, documented at the page below.

runbook for kahop-kajop: https://rundeck.ordinio.test/display/secrets/pipeline/issue/pages/repo/browse/e5732776e07d1285107e5aeb

Subject: Weekly cash-box run — Friday

To the dispatch desk,

The weekly cash box from the Corven Street branch is scheduled for Friday morning pickup as usual. Records team: please have the count sheet sealed inside the outer pouch and the transfer entry logged before the courier arrives. The box must remain in the locked transit case from our office to the Hadleigh counting room. The courier hand-over instruction follows.

— Operations

courier memo of yawep-yafog: the pramir ulaix courier leaves the ulavan aldix frair zorok oliiel joreth rusdor fenvan ledger at gate 1305 under passcode 514738